My 2001 Caravan goes into limp mode about every 2 weeks. You never know when it is going to happen. I am a new mom with 2 children who feels that this is very dangerous. The headlights go out, the fan won't blow, it won't go above 30 mph, the speedometor goes up and down, the gears all light up, and the back speaker makes a noice. I can get it to snap out by knocking on the fuse box not by restarting the car. I am worried about the headlights going out while i am driving at night. They say it can't be fixed enless it is acting up because they don't know what wire may be bad. Please help.

Judging by similar posts on this forum this is becoming a common problem. It appears to be a poor connection in a wire harness either at the computer or fuse panel. There should be a recall for this.
